University of Maryland College of Behavioral and Social Sciences Summer Research Initiative

The University of Maryland College of Behavioral and Social Sciences Summer Research Initiative is an 8-week program to provide rising juniors and seniors an opportunity to increase their interest in and learn about doctoral-level training, and provide basic research skills that can be applied in the social, behavioral and economic science fields. The program has a special emphasis on population groups underrepresented in these fields. Students will be provided a meaningful research experience by working with a faculty mentor in one of their nine academic departments: African American Studies, Anthropology, Criminology and Criminal Justice, Economics, Geography, Government and Politics, Hearing and Speech Sciences, Psychology, and Sociology. Students will be provided round-trip airfare, meals, room, and board in University on-campus housing and a stipend.
